Summary of anatomical site and sub-site infections before and after the trial

Case 1 Before: Larynx (aryepiglottis fold/false and true vocal cords/arytenoids/anterior and posterior commissures/sub-glottis) and trachea/lungs
After: Larynx (aryepiglottis folds/false and true vocal cords/anterior and posterior commisure/sub-glottis) and trachea/bronchi/lungs
Case 2
Before: Larynx (aryepiglottis folds/false and true vocal cords/arytenoid/anterior commissure/sub-glottis)
After: Larynx (aryepiglottis fold/false vocal cords/true vocal cord)
Case 3
Before: Larynx (true vocal cords/anterior and posterior commissures)
After: Larynx (true vocal cord/anterior commissure)
Case 4
Before: Larynx (false and true vocal cords/arytenoid), palate and pharynx
After: Larynx (true vocal cords)
Case 5
Before: Larynx (true vocal cords/anterior commissure)
After: Larynx (false vocal cords/true vocal cord)
Case 6
Before: Larynx (aryepiglottis fold/arytenoid/posterior commissure) and pharynx
After: Larynx (laryngeal epiglottis surface/aryepiglottis folds/false and true vocal cords/arytenoids/anterior and posterior commissures)
Case 7
Before: Larynx (false vocal cord/true vocal cord/anterior and posterior commissures)
After: Clear
Case 8 Before: Larynx (laryngeal epiglottis surface/aryepiglottis fold/arytenoid/anterior commissure)
After: Larynx (anterior and posterior commissures)
